Subject: [PATCH v2 1/5] NFSD: OFFLOAD_CANCEL should mark an async COPY as completed

From: Chuck Lever <chuck.lever@oracle.com>

Update the status of an async COPY operation when it has been
stopped. OFFLOAD_STATUS needs to indicate that the COPY is no longer
running.

Signed-off-by: Chuck Lever <chuck.lever@oracle.com>
---
 fs/nfsd/nfs4proc.c | 5 ++++-
 1 file changed, 4 insertions(+), 1 deletion(-)

diff --git a/fs/nfsd/nfs4proc.c b/fs/nfsd/nfs4proc.c
index f6e06c779d09..9a0e68aa246f 100644
--- a/fs/nfsd/nfs4proc.c
+++ b/fs/nfsd/nfs4proc.c
@@ -1379,8 +1379,11 @@ static void nfs4_put_copy(struct nfsd4_copy *copy)
 static void nfsd4_stop_copy(struct nfsd4_copy *copy)
 {
 	trace_nfsd_copy_async_cancel(copy);
-	if (!test_and_set_bit(NFSD4_COPY_F_STOPPED, &copy->cp_flags))
+	if (!test_and_set_bit(NFSD4_COPY_F_STOPPED, &copy->cp_flags)) {
 		kthread_stop(copy->copy_task);
+		copy->nfserr = nfs_ok;
+		set_bit(NFSD4_COPY_F_COMPLETED, &copy->cp_flags);
+	}
 	nfs4_put_copy(copy);
 }
